Henry's Fork
Cooler weather will slow the advance of giant and golden stoneflies upstream. It will also reduce the number of these insects flying. However, trout are now aware of their presence, so dry patterns will remain effective. Do not overlook presenting caddis life cycle patters on slower sections of the river. The recent cool weather has dropped water temperatures to levels more suitable for trout in most of the river. Flow at Box Canyon is about 285 cfs, below Ashton Dam is about 950 cfs and about 900 cfs at St. Anthony cfs.
